show/hide this revision's text 4 Removed unusual tagging
show/hide this revision's text 3 i am stupid

I have seen the ASP.NET community buzzing about MVC. I know the basics of its origin, and that there are many sites (unless I am mistaken, stack overflow itself) are based on ASP.NET MVCsite.

From everything I have heard and read about MVC it seems to be the future of ASP.NET development. But since I don't usually dabble in the .NET web so development I am left wondering the following: when is it appropriate to use MVC and when is it not, and why? Example Examples of great (and terrible) use of MVC would be fascinating.
Though I realize there are other implementations of MVC view other languages like RoR I am more interested on its impact for .NET programmers.

If this has already been gone over, my apologies!

show/hide this revision's text 2 edited tags
show/hide this revision's text 1